Description
Key Responsibilities: • Lead and oversee lease renewal activities for existing MR D.I.Y. retail stores across Malaysia, ensuring tenancy agreements are executed within the stipulated timeline. • Negotiate with landlords on lease renewals, rental revisions, tenancy terms, operational matters, store closures, and ownership changes while safeguarding the Company's interests. • Review tenancy agreements, letters of offer, and other lease-related documentation in collaboration with internal stakeholders and legal representatives. • Manage and maintain the Property Management System (PMS), including the creation, modification, and updating of property and tenancy records for new and existing stores. • Ensure the accuracy and integrity of tenancy, rental, and property databases through timely data maintenance and administration. • Coordinate closely with Legal, Finance, Operations, landlords, and external solicitors to facilitate lease execution, payment matters, and operational requirements. • Build and maintain strong working relationships with landlords, shopping mall management, and property owners to support long-term business partnerships. • Monitor lease expiry schedules, rental obligations, and key property milestones to ensure compliance with company policies and departmental KPIs. • Prepare and analyse reports relating to lease renewals, tenancy status, rental commitments, and property portfolio performance for management review. • Support the Senior Manager in driving process improvements, ensuring compliance with departmental SOPs, and providing guidance to junior team members where required. Requirements: • Bachelor's Degree or Diploma in Property Management, Estate Management, Real Estate, Business Administration, or a related discipline. • Minimum 5 years of experience in retail property management, real estate, leasing, or a related field. • Hands-on experience managing lease renewals, tenancy administration, and landlord negotiations. • Experience using Property Management Systems (PMS) or similar real estate management systems is an added advantage. • Strong understanding of tenancy agreements, lease administration, and retail property management practices. • Excellent negotiation, stakeholder management, and interpersonal communication skills. • Ability to build and maintain effective relationships with landlords, mall management, legal firms, and internal stakeholders. • Strong analytical, organisational, and problem-solving skills with attention to detail. • Proficient in Microsoft Excel, Word, and PowerPoint. • Ability to manage multiple priorities independently while meeting deadlines. • Familiar with company policies, lease documentation, and property-related legal processes. • Possess a valid driving licence and be willing to travel nationwide when required. • Self-motivated, independent, and capable of working with minimal supervision.
